Anita Darian has been a serious working singer for nearly 50 years. She first came to popular attention as a featured singer with the short-lived and critically, if not financially, successful Sauter-Finegan band of the mid-1950s. She settled in New York City, where she's worked in everything from opera and classical recitals to television jingles and cartoon voice-overs.
